Key Ingredients for Steamed Artichokes
Artichokes: For the best flavor and texture in your steamed artichokes, opt for the freshest whole artichokes you can find. Look for those with vibrant green leaves that are tightly packed together. The longer the stem, the better, as it’s both tender and delicious!
Lemon Juice: A splash of lemon juice is essential in this recipe. Not only does it add a delightful brightness, but it also serves a practical purpose—it prevents browning, keeping the artichokes looking as fresh as they taste throughout the cooking process.
Mayo: For the dipping sauce, mayo is key. It creates a creamy texture that works beautifully alongside the tender artichokes. Trust me, this combination elevates your snacking experience!
Sour Cream: To achieve a balance in flavor, I like to add sour cream to the mix. It introduces a tangy zest that perfectly complements the richness of the mayo, making your dipping experience both creamy and delightful.
Seasoning: Simple seasoning can transform your steamed artichokes into an extraordinary dish. A sprinkle of salt and pepper enhances their natural flavor, making every bite a little more special.

Different Dipping Sauces to Try
The beauty of steamed artichokes lies in their versatility. Pairing them with an array of dipping sauces can elevate your tasting experience. Here are some delicious ideas to consider:
-
Garlic Aioli: Creamy and garlicky, this dipping sauce is a classic choice. Made with mayonnaise, garlic, lemon juice, and a pinch of salt, it complements the tender leaves perfectly.
-
Lemon Butter Sauce: For a rich and zesty dip, melt some butter and add freshly squeezed lemon juice. A sprinkle of herbs like parsley or dill can add an aromatic touch.
-
Balsamic Reduction: For something a bit tangy and sweet, a balsamic glaze made by reducing balsamic vinegar creates a luxurious contrast to the nuttiness of the artichoke.
-
Spicy Mustard Dip: Mix Dijon mustard with honey and a splash of apple cider vinegar for a sweet and spicy kick that pairs beautifully with the earthy notes of the artichoke.
-
Herbed Yogurt Dip: Combine plain yogurt with fresh herbs like dill or chives, garlic, and lemon juice for a refreshing and healthy option.
With these varied dipping sauces, your steamed artichokes will never feel dull, making each bite more exciting than the last.

Ensuring perfect tenderness
Getting the right tenderness in steamed artichokes is crucial for a successful dish. Here’s how to achieve that melt-in-your-mouth texture:
- Size Matters: Choose medium-sized artichokes. Larger ones can take longer to cook and may end up more fibrous.
- Trim and Clean: Before steaming, cut off the top inch and trim the tips of the leaves. This not only enhances presentation but also reduces the chances of the leaves being tough.
- Proper Steaming Time: Steam your artichokes for about 30-45 minutes, depending on their size. A fork should easily pierce the base when they’re perfectly cooked.
- Visual Cues: Look for the outer leaves to start peeling away easily, as this is a good indicator that they are ready.
- Taste Test: Don’t be afraid to sample a leaf near the end of the steaming process. If it’s tender and flavorful, you’re in business!

How do I know when artichokes are done?
Determining the doneness of steamed artichokes is key to achieving that tender, buttery taste. You’ll know they’re ready when the leaves can be easily pulled off and the base of the artichoke is tender when pierced with a knife. Typically, steaming for 30-45 minutes will do the trick, but don’t hesitate to check for tenderness as you go!
Can I steam artichokes without a steamer?
Absolutely! If you don’t have a steamer basket, you can create a makeshift steaming setup using a large pot and a heatproof dish. Just add a couple of inches of water into the pot, place the dish (holding the artichokes) above the water level, and cover it tightly. This method effectively traps the steam needed for cooking.
What can I use instead of mayo in the dipping sauce?
If mayo isn’t your thing, there are various alternatives to make your dipping sauce just as delicious. Greek yogurt can provide a creamy texture, or you might try sour cream for a tangy flavor. For a lighter option, blending avocado with a squeeze of lemon is not only tasty but nutritious as well!

Steamed Artichokes with Dipping Sauce
- Total Time: 40 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
Delicious steamed artichokes served with a creamy dipping sauce.
Ingredients
- 3 whole artichokes, stem trimmed, cut in half, and choke cut out (see notes)
- water
- 2 T lemon juice (see notes)
- 1/2 cup mayo
- 1/4 cup sour cream
- 1 T lemon juice (see notes)
Instructions
- Choose artichokes with the longest stem since the stems are tasty.
- Trim the stem and peel away any discolored parts.
- Cut the entire artichoke plus stem in half lengthwise.
- Use a sharp knife to cut along the bottom of the choke (where it meets the artichoke heart) and pull the choke out.
- Optionally, use kitchen shears to cut off the sharp ends of the leaves.
- While trimming the artichokes, put several inches of water into a stovetop vegetable steamer and let it come to a boil.
- Add a few tablespoons of fresh-frozen lemon juice to keep the artichokes from turning brown, if desired.
- When the water is boiling, put the artichokes in, cut side down, cover with the lid, and steam for 25 minutes.
- Check for doneness by piercing the artichoke heart with a fork.
- If you prefer, read instructions for cooking artichokes in an Instant Pot.
- While artichokes cook, whisk together mayo, sour cream, and fresh-frozen lemon juice to make the dipping sauce, starting with one tablespoon of lemon juice and adjusting to taste.
- The sauce can be made ahead and kept in the fridge for a few days.
Notes
- Cooking time may vary depending on the size of the artichokes.
- Using fresh-frozen lemon juice can help prevent browning.
